General Information

Title: Si bona suscepimus
Composer: Hans Leo Hassler
Source of text: Job 2:10 & 1:21

Number of voices: 8vv   Voicing: SSAATTTB

Genre: SacredMotet

Language: Latin
Instruments: A cappella

Description: Hassler's setting of a text from the Office of the Dead.
